What is an energy storage system (ESS)?

An Energy Storage System (ESS) is a technology designed to store excess energy for future use. It captures energy during periods of low demand or high production and releases it when the demand exceeds supply. This process is vital for maintaining a stable energy supply, optimizing energy usage, and integrating renewable energy sources effectively.

What are some technologies used for energy storage?

Energy storage captures energy when it is produced and stores it for later use through a variety of technologies including pumped hydro, batteries, compressed air, hydrogen storage and thermal storage.

Which energy storage technologies can be used in a distributed network?

Battery, flywheel energy storage, super capacitor, and superconducting magnetic energy storage are technically feasible for use in distribution networks. With an energy density of 620 kWh/m3, Li-ion batteries appear to be highly capable technologies for enhanced energy storage implementation in the built environment.

What is a thermal energy storage system?

A thermal energy storage system is a system that stores thermal energy for later use. It typically consists of a hot and cold store, compressors, turbines, and generators. The storage mediums could include molten salt, molten aluminum, molten silicon, etc. When discharging, the temperature differential between the cold and hot stores is used to convert thermal energy back into electricity.
